This release contains firmware version CSLB for STX drives. Vendor model numbers ST6000NM035A, ST8000NM014A. Drive need to be at firmware version CSL9 for this update to complete. Customers with drives that are on firmware version CSL7 need to update to firmware version CSL9 first.

Fixes & Enhancements

Fixes:
Fix issues that can cause IOEDC errors.

Enhancements:
Improve performance for certain workloads
Enhance sense code reporting accuracy
Increased BMS interval timer value

This update will not run if any of the following conditions exist
1. Any Virtual Disk that is not optimal.
2. A RAID container that is performing a Background Initialization or Consistency Check.
3. A Rebuild, Resync, or copyback function is taking place.
4. A RAID set that is Partially Degraded or in a Degraded state.
5. Drives are on firmware version CSL7


This update will run on drives remaining in a RAID set that is in a Offline state.

There is an architectural constraint with Dell DUP HDD firmware update utility, related to system memory utilization, which is typically encountered on systems with minimal system memory, memory-intensive configurations, multiple RAID controllers, or memory-intensive applications. This issue is typically reported as - The operation was not successful because the device buffer write has failed. And will result in an aborted attempt to update firmware on the identified HDD. Error codes associated with this failure mode include 8009 and 8017. Once an error is detected, the update session is aborted. There is no data integrity or data availability risk associated with this issue. Subsequent attempts to update the HDD firmware may succeed, particularly if system resources are freed up.
